xref: /plan9/sys/src/cmd/usb/usbd/mkfile (revision 91e577b2f0a5259a0686978e844708e123963698)
1</$objtype/mkfile
2
3TARG=usbd
4OFILES=\
5	usbd.$O\
6	dev.$O\
7	devtab.$O\
8
9HFILES=\
10	usbd.h\
11	../lib/usb.h\
12	../lib/usbfs.h\
13
14LIBD=../lib/usbdev.a$O
15LIBU=../lib/usb.a$O
16LIB=\
17	$LIBD\
18	$LIBU\
19
20UPDATE=\
21	$HFILES\
22	${OFILES:%.$O=%.c}\
23	mkfile\
24	/sys/man/3/usb\
25
26BIN=/$objtype/bin/usb
27</sys/src/cmd/mkone
28
29CFLAGS=-I../lib $CFLAGS
30CLEANFILES=devtab.c
31
32$LIBU:
33	cd ../lib
34	mk install
35	mk clean
36
37devtab.c: usbdb ../lib/usb.h mkdev
38	./mkdev >$target
39
40